This book provides a clear and actionable framework for navigating the complexities of educational change. It moves beyond theoretical concepts, offering school and district leaders practical tools and strategies to effectively lead their teams through periods of transformation. You'll discover how to cultivate a shared vision, build consensus among stakeholders, and implement sustainable change initiatives. The book breaks down the often-daunting process of change management into four essential skills, each explored in depth with real-world examples and case studies. Learn how to foster a culture of collaboration and innovation within your school or district, empowering educators to embrace new ideas and strive for continuous improvement. Whether you're facing shifting educational policies, implementing new technologies, or navigating organizational restructuring, this book equips you with the skills and confidence to lead with purpose and achieve lasting positive change.
